How often is the list updated?

Most agencies refresh their records on a regular schedule, which can range from daily to weekly updates. Some platforms may pull data directly from official feeds, while others rely on manual uploads. Because of this, the timing between an actual booking and its appearance online can vary.

What information is included in each entry?

Typical entries may include the person’s name, date of birth, location of booking, charges or alleged offense, booking number, and time of detention. Personal details such as address or full background are generally limited to protect privacy and comply with regulations.

Are these records accurate and reliable?

The data is sourced from official law enforcement records, but mistakes can happen. Names, dates, or charges might be entered incorrectly, or a person may be released or have charges dropped shortly after booking. It is always wise to cross-reference with court records or official statements for important matters.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One common misconception is that every booking leads directly to charges or convictions. In reality, many cases are resolved through diversion programs, dismissals, or acquittals. Another misunderstanding is that these lists reflect overall crime trends, when in fact they only capture a narrow snapshot of interactions with law enforcement at a specific point in time.

Believing that all information is always complete can also lead to confusion. Data entry delays, system errors, or redactions for privacy can affect what appears online. Taking the time to verify details through multiple reliable sources reduces the risk of acting on incomplete or misunderstood information.
